The manufacturing process of carbon fibre reinforced plastic parts may lead to wrinkles and fibre waviness in the final part. These imperfections in the fibre orientation can result in parts that do not fulfill their functional requirements. In this book, a methodology is presented which enables predicting wrinkles. Thus, the methodology allows a virtual design of the manufacturing process in an industrial environment. An essential part of this approach is a modelling which improves the predictive quality regarding wrinkles compared to the state of the art. Furthermore, an analysis and a model of an innovative restraining system is described that is capable to prevent the formation of wrinkles. Finally, two experimental methods are presented which allow characterising the fibre orientation in the intermediate plies of multi-layer composites.
